Webb4 feb. 2010 · If you open up a command prompt (Start > Run > Cmd) and type “shutdown”, you will see that there are a bundle of arguments you can use with the shutdown command. The -m argument followed by the machine name, and a -r (restart trigger) will shutdown your computer. The best way for me to explain it is through examples. It’s … Webb9 aug. 2024 · The net send command is a Command Prompt command used to send messages to users, computers, and messaging aliases on the network. It's one of many net commands . Windows XP was the last version of Windows to include the net send command. The msg command replaces this command in Windows 11, Windows 10 , … hatchleaf inc
